Patent number: 8718052Abstract: A method and system for connecting signal paths in a circuit arrangement with multiband capability for processing and/or influencing signals in radio communication, on the basis of which at least the transmission paths of a corresponding circuit arrangement are activated or deactivated on the basis of the presence of a transmitted signal from a terminal which is operated with the circuit arrangement. The transmission paths, which are deactivated in a basic state of the circuit arrangement, are periodically checked in succession for the presence of a transmitted signal from the terminal with a multiplexer that forms a functional component of a detection unit and that is switched through by a controller for sequential scanning of the transmission paths for the presence of such a transmitted signal. If a signal is present, only a transmission path for the correct frequency band of the transmitted signal is activated and continuously checked for the presence of a transmitted signal.Type: GrantFiled: June 24, 2010Date of Patent: May 6, 2014Assignee: Funkwerk Dabendorf GmbHInventors: Helmut Nast, Christoph Gebauer, Raimo Jacobi

Patent number: 8406820Abstract: A detection circuit has a detector unit for detecting a transmitted signal from a mobile radio terminal. The detection circuit forms a part of a circuit arrangement for processing or influencing received signals and transmitted signals associated with the mobile radio terminal (accessory circuit). It is involved in the accessory circuit via a switching means, which is arranged in a transmission path upstream of at least one transmission power amplifier which can be activated upon detection of a transmitted signal, and is coupled to the transmission path via a coupling element which is arranged downstream of the transmission power amplifier. At the start of the transmission burst, the whole power of the transmitted signal is first of all supplied to the detector unit before said detector unit changes over the transmitted signal to the transmission power amplifier by operating the switching means.Type: GrantFiled: July 10, 2009Date of Patent: March 26, 2013Assignee: Funkwerk Dabendorf GmbHInventor: Helmut Nast

Publication number: 20130045695Abstract: A device transmits and receives radio signals, in particular radio signals in a cellular radio network. The device contains a first transmitting antenna for transmitting radio signals and a second receiving antenna. The antennas transmit and/or receive radio signals in different frequency ranges. The antennas are connected to a common cable connection via a radio signal splitter, by which cable connection the device can be connected to a radio terminal. The device contains a first radio signal amplifier disposed in a first radio signal path and/or a second radio signal amplifier disposed in a second radio signal path. The transmitting antenna and the receiving antenna have attenuation with respect to feedback of a radio signal transmitted from the transmitting antenna to the receiving antenna due to the arrangement thereof relative to each other and due to the transmitting and/or receiving characteristics thereof.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 19, 2011Publication date: February 21, 2013Applicant: FUNKWERK DABENDORF GMBHInventors: Helmut Nast, Ronald Heldt, Rainer Holz, Thomas Bartsch

Patent number: 8380136Abstract: The invention relates to a multi-band, multi-part circuit arrangement for compensating the attenuation of HF wireless signals in the signal paths between a transmitting and receiving device and an external antenna. The circuit arrangement comprises power amplifiers, receiving amplifiers, at least one splitter, at least one combiner, duplexers and frequency and/or band filters, HF switching means as well as a detector circuit for the detection of transmission signals from the transmitting and receiving device and for providing control signals for the HF switching means.Type: GrantFiled: January 26, 2008Date of Patent: February 19, 2013Assignee: Funkwerk Dabendorf GmbHInventors: Helmut Nast, Raimo Jacobi, Frank Heyder

Patent number: 8238984Abstract: A system for accommodating a mobile telephone in a compartment in a motor vehicle. The compartment is electromagnetically shielded against the emission of radio signals from the mobile telephone. The system includes a connector for transmitting an antenna signal from an antenna of the motor vehicle to the mobile telephone, an electromagnetically shielded housing with an opening for inserting the mobile telephone into the housing and for removing the mobile telephone from the housing, and an elastically deformable retaining element that is designed to be electromagnetically absorbing. In a closed state of the housing in which the opening of the housing is at least partially closed, the opening at least partially shields against the emission of radio signals of the mobile telephone from the housing. In the closed state the retaining element secures the mobile telephone in a temporary position.Type: GrantFiled: April 5, 2007Date of Patent: August 7, 2012Assignee: Funkwerk Dabendorf GmbHInventors: Udo Pursche, Michael Fenske, Ronald Heldt, Raimo Jacobi, Thomas Bartsch

Patent number: 7133652Abstract: The invention concerns a circuit arrangement for compensation of attenuation in an antenna lead for a mobile wireless device. The circuit arrangement is suitable for operation in a wireless network, in which the higher or the lower of two frequency ranges defined in one frequency band is used selectively for transmitting and the other frequency range is used for receiving the wireless signals within the one frequency band.Type: GrantFiled: March 21, 2002Date of Patent: November 7, 2006Assignee: Funkwerk Dabendorf GmbHInventors: Helmut Nast, Raimo Jacobi
